Why has the price changed?
Directline Holidays are committed to finding you the holiday you want for the best price available. In common with most online retail travel agencies, our prices are collated from many of the major Tour Operators, low cost airlines and bed suppliers. In many cases we receive this data from suppliers first thing in the morning. Occasionally this means the website price displayed on the search results might not be the latest available price (for example where other customers have made bookings since these prices were collated).

When you click on the green button we do a live availability check. This may change the actual price offered for your chosen holiday (either up or down). Whenever we detect a price change of more than £10 we display a prominent message to alert you. Similarly, if for technical reasons a particular holiday cannot be booked online, we display the 'call to book' message. Our sales team then conduct a live price search and will advise you of the current price.

What methods of payment do you accept online and what are your card charges?
We are pleased to be able to accept a variety of payment options for your convenience. Delta, Switch/Maestro, MasterCard and Visa are all currently accepted.

We do not charge fees to our customers using debit cards to book new holidays with us. Credit cards will incur a fee based on 2.5% of the holiday value.

Debit cards   = no fee on new bookings
Credit cards  = 2.5%
Paypal          = 1.99% (via website only)

Debit cards issued outside of the UK will be processed as credit cards, and subject to our credit card charge. Your bank or card issuer may also apply a foreign transaction fee. Cards are accepted subject to security and fraud checks.

What deposit and payment schemes do you offer online?
For the majority of our bookings we are able to offer payment upfront of just a deposit with the remaining balance being required 6 weeks prior to your departure date. If you are making your booking within 6 weeks then we would seek full payment at time of booking. The deposit amount required will vary depending on the best available deals we have to offer at the time. From time to time we and or our suppliers run promotions which allow us to provide you with lower deposit options. Such options will be advised during the payment section of our website. In cases whereby we are acting as the agent for another tour operator, payment terms may require full payment to be provided to us within 12 weeks of departure.
